loomBrE /luːm/NAmE /luːm/ verbpresent simple - I / you / we / they loom BrE /luːm/ NAmE /luːm/present simple - he / she / it looms BrE /luːmz/ NAmE /luːmz/past simple loomed BrE /luːmd/ NAmE /luːmd/past participle loomed BrE /luːmd/ NAmE /luːmd/ -ing form looming BrE /ˈluːmɪŋ/ NAmE /ˈluːmɪŋ/ [I] (+ adv./prep.) to appear as a large shape that is not clear, especially in a frightening or threatening way 赫然耸现;(尤指)令人惊恐地隐现◆A dark shape loomed up ahead of us. 一个黑糊糊的影子隐隐出现在我们的前面。 [I] to appear important or threatening and likely to happen soon 显得突出;逼近◆There was a crisis looming. 危机迫在眉睫。 ●ˌloom ˈlargeto be worrying or frightening and seem hard to avoid 令人忧虑,令人惊恐(并似乎难以避免)◆The prospect of war loomed large. 战争的阴影在逼近,令人忧虑。 loomBrE /luːm/NAmE /luːm/ nouna machine for making cloth by twisting threads between other threads which go in a different direction 织布机 |
